(a) A private investigator executing a capias or an arrest warrant on behalf of a bail bond surety may not: (1) enter a residence without the consent of the occupants; (2) execute the capias or warrant without written authorization from the surety; (3) wear, carry, or display any uniform, badge, shield, or other insignia or emblem that implies that the private investigator is an employee, officer, or agent of the federal government, the state, or a political subdivision of the state; Can a bounty hunter enter your house without a warrant. (a) No person, other than a certified law enforcement officer, shall be authorized to apprehend, detain, or arrest a bail fugitive unless that person meets one of the following conditions: (1) Is a bail as defined in subdivision (b) of Section 1299.01 or a depositor of bail as defined in subdivision (c) of Section 1299.01. If the defendant fails to appear (commonly called skipping bail), the judge issues a bench warrant for the person and requires the bail bondsman to bring back the defendant or pay the entire bail amount. Just 4 states Oregon, Kentucky, Wisconsin, and Illinois ban the practice of bounty hunting altogether. You may be asking, can a bail bondsman enter your home? In the United States, bounty hunters have varying levels of authority in the execution of their duties. When you sign the agreement to pay a bail bonds agency a percent of the bail money and you end up missing your court date, usually in the terms of the agreement you, authorize the bonding company to use certain necessary force and tactics in order to find you and bring you back to jail.
